Perhaps the most recognized chant in the tradition, Om Namah Shivaya is the Mahamantra (Great Mantra). In the Sri Sri renditions, this chant is often sung with a hypnotic, rhythmic cadence. It is dedicated to Shiva, the aspect of the Divine representing transformation and the destruction of negativity. The following are among the most recognized chants

What sets Sri Sri Chants apart from traditional recitations by priests is the melodic, accessible, and deeply meditative presentation. While maintaining the strict integrity of the Sanskrit pronunciation—which is crucial for the energetic effect of the mantra—Sri Sri introduces a musicality that allows the listener to slip easily into a meditative state.
